How is the prevention of money laundering addressed in the information technology and digital financial services sector in Paraguay?

The prevention of money laundering in the information technology and digital financial services sector in Paraguay is addressed through specific regulations. Companies operating in this sector are subject to due diligence measures, customer identification and reporting of suspicious transactions. Supervision by SEPRELAD and collaboration with sector regulators guarantee compliance with regulations and strengthen the country's capacity to prevent money laundering in digital transactions. Constant adaptation to the dynamics of the technology sector is essential to maintain the effectiveness of preventive measures. Collaborating with fintech experts helps address emerging challenges in this space.

What are the specific obligations of private financial sector entities in relation to the detection and prevention of money laundering and terrorist financing, and how does the government ensure compliance?

Entities in the private financial sector have the obligation to implement strict controls for the detection and prevention of money laundering and the financing of terrorism. This includes customer identification, transaction monitoring, and suspicious activity reporting. The government ensures compliance through regular audits, review of internal practices and the imposition of sanctions in case of non-compliance.
